Description
Bazett Fraga McRemitz operates as a Sealing Designation Enforcer for the Mage’s Association, hunting rogue magi. During *Fate/kaleid liner Prisma Illya 2wei!*, she pursues the recovery of Class Cards—artifacts embedding Heroic Spirit data—confronting Luviagelita Edelfelt and Rin Tohsaka. She effortlessly overpowers both, demolishing Luvia’s mansion and securing four cards. Though disciplined in her duties, she voices frustration at losing the opportunity to analyze the Kaleidosticks’ functions directly.

Born in Ireland as heir to an ancient magus lineage estranged from the Mage’s Association, Bazett joined the organization at fifteen. Political ostracization drove her to become an Enforcer. Before *Prisma Illya*, she served as Lancer’s original Master in the Fifth Holy Grail War, summoning Cú Chulainn via his earrings. Kirei Kotomine betrayed her, severing her arm to claim her Command Spells. Left to perish, she survived through Avenger’s intervention, trapped in a recurring four-day cycle in *Fate/hollow ataraxia* until resolving the temporal anomaly.

In battle, Bazett wields rune-enhanced gloves to uproot terrain and shatter defensive magecraft. Her resilience stems from a Noble Phantasm-class Rune of Resurrection, instantly healing fatal wounds if her heart stops. Fragarach, her trump card, reverses causality to pierce an opponent’s heart before their ultimate attack activates. This counters Miyu’s Bellerophon in *Prisma Illya 2wei!* by targeting her summoned Pegasus preemptively.

Her *Prisma Illya* interactions exemplify a pragmatic, uncompromising approach. She rebuffs Illya and Miyu’s emotional pleas, prioritizing her mission even against children. After discovering an eighth Class Card, she allies temporarily with Rin, trading three cards for intel. Financial constraints force her into menial work like selling ice pops, though her stern presence discourages customers. A survival curse binding her to Illya, placed by Rin, is later broken by Caren, freeing her to challenge Gilgamesh alone.

During the Mirror World clash with Gilgamesh, Bazett endures the Gate of Babylon’s onslaught. Her Rune of Resurrection and tactical Fragarach use briefly incapacitate him, aiding the group’s retreat. Post-battle, she monitors Gilgamesh’s movements before being transported to a parallel world post-conflict.

Defined by stoicism, relentless dedication, and solitude, Bazett adheres to a personal code—sparing non-combatants and avoiding superfluous violence. Subtle vulnerability surfaces in her reliance on Avenger and dry humor, such as accepting makeshift sleeping arrangements due to poverty. Loneliness permeates her interactions, underscoring a complex persona balancing duty with unspoken isolation.
